Explanation:
Detailed explanation-1: -Which of the following is NOT specifically a plant adaptation for life on land? auxins.
Detailed explanation-2: -Plants have evolved several adaptations to life on land, including embryo retention, a cuticle, stomata, and vascular tissue.
Detailed explanation-3: -Development of roots, stem and leaves are major land adaptations on land.
